143 static int single_read (char *name, FILE *fh)
144 {
145 char buffer[1024];
146 char *fields[4];
147 const int max_fields = STATIC_ARRAY_SIZE (fields);
148 int fields_num, read = 0;
150 counter_t link_rx, link_tx;
151 counter_t tun_rx, tun_tx;
152 counter_t pre_compress, post_compress;
153 counter_t pre_decompress, post_decompress;
154 counter_t overhead_rx, overhead_tx;
156 link_rx = 0;
157 link_tx = 0;
158 tun_rx = 0;
159 tun_tx = 0;
160 pre_compress = 0;
161 post_compress = 0;
162 pre_decompress = 0;
163 post_decompress = 0;
164 overhead_rx = 0;
165 overhead_tx = 0;
167 while (fgets (buffer, sizeof (buffer), fh) != NULL)
168 {
169 fields_num = openvpn_strsplit (buffer, fields, max_fields);
171 /* status file is generated by openvpn/sig.c:print_status()
172 * http://svn.openvpn.net/projects/openvpn/trunk/openvpn/sig.c
173 *
174 * The line we're expecting has 2 fields. We ignore all lines
175 * with more or less fields.
176 */
177 if (fields_num != 2)
178 {
179 continue;
180 }
182 if (strcmp (fields[0], "TUN/TAP read bytes") == 0)
183 {
184 /* read from the system and sent over the tunnel */
185 tun_tx = atoll (fields[1]);
186 }
187 else if (strcmp (fields[0], "TUN/TAP write bytes") == 0)
188 {
189 /* read from the tunnel and written in the system */
190 tun_rx = atoll (fields[1]);
191 }
192 else if (strcmp (fields[0], "TCP/UDP read bytes") == 0)
193 {
194 link_rx = atoll (fields[1]);
195 }
196 else if (strcmp (fields[0], "TCP/UDP write bytes") == 0)
197 {
198 link_tx = atoll (fields[1]);
199 }
200 else if (strcmp (fields[0], "pre-compress bytes") == 0)
201 {
202 pre_compress = atoll (fields[1]);
203 }
204 else if (strcmp (fields[0], "post-compress bytes") == 0)
205 {
206 post_compress = atoll (fields[1]);
207 }
208 else if (strcmp (fields[0], "pre-decompress bytes") == 0)
209 {
210 pre_decompress = atoll (fields[1]);
211 }
212 else if (strcmp (fields[0], "post-decompress bytes") == 0)
213 {
214 post_decompress = atoll (fields[1]);
215 }
216 }
218 iostats_submit (name, "traffic", link_rx, link_tx);
220 /* we need to force this order to avoid negative values with these unsigned */
221 overhead_rx = (((link_rx - pre_decompress) + post_decompress) - tun_rx);
222 overhead_tx = (((link_tx - post_compress) + pre_compress) - tun_tx);
224 iostats_submit (name, "overhead", overhead_rx, overhead_tx);
226 if (store_compression)
227 {
228 compression_submit (name, "data_in", post_decompress, pre_decompress);
229 compression_submit (name, "data_out", pre_compress, post_compress);
230 }
232 read = 1;
234 return (read);
235 } /* int single_read */

485 static int version_detect (const char *filename)
486 {
487 FILE *fh;
488 char buffer[1024];
489 int version = 0;
491 /* Sanity checking. We're called from the config handling routine, so
492 * better play it save. */
493 if ((filename == NULL) || (*filename == 0))
494 return (0);
496 fh = fopen (filename, "r");
497 if (fh == NULL)
498 {
499 char errbuf[1024];
500 WARNING ("openvpn plugin: Unable to read \"%s\": %s", filename,
501 sstrerror (errno, errbuf, sizeof (errbuf)));
502 return (0);
503 }
505 /* now search for the specific multimode data format */
506 while ((fgets (buffer, sizeof (buffer), fh)) != NULL)
507 {
508 /* we look at the first line searching for SINGLE mode configuration */
509 if (strcmp (buffer, VSSTRING) == 0)
510 {
511 DEBUG ("openvpn plugin: found status file version SINGLE");
512 version = SINGLE;
513 break;
514 }
515 /* searching for multi version 1 */
516 else if (strcmp (buffer, V1STRING) == 0)
517 {
518 DEBUG ("openvpn plugin: found status file version MULTI1");
519 version = MULTI1;
520 break;
521 }
522 /* searching for multi version 2 */
523 else if (strcmp (buffer, V2STRING) == 0)
524 {
525 DEBUG ("openvpn plugin: found status file version MULTI2");
526 version = MULTI2;
527 break;
528 }
529 /* searching for multi version 3 */
530 else if (strcmp (buffer, V3STRING) == 0)
531 {
532 DEBUG ("openvpn plugin: found status file version MULTI3");
533 version = MULTI3;
534 break;
535 }
536 }
538 if (version == 0)
539 {
540 /* This is only reached during configuration, so complaining to
541 * the user is in order. */
542 NOTICE ("openvpn plugin: %s: Unknown file format, please "
543 "report this as bug. Make sure to include "
544 "your status file, so the plugin can "
545 "be adapted.", filename);
546 }
548 fclose (fh);
550 return version;
551 } /* int version_detect */
